Solution Overview

Problem

Sheet metal stamping operations face downtime and potential equipment damage due to web feedstock material jams in scrap choppers, leading to increased production losses and repair costs.

Innovation Solution

A web jam detector system comprising a web detection bar with conductive fingers and a detection circuit that autonomously monitors the presence of feedstock material during chopper cycles, providing real-time feedback to shut down the scrap chopper if a jam is detected.

A web jam detector and associated method are provided for detecting a jam of feedstock material in a scrap chopper. A web detection bar, mounted to the scrap chopper, includes a plurality of web detection fingers. The plurality of web detection fingers are made of an electrically conductive material, are electrically connected to and extend outwardly from the web detection bar, and are positioned to contact the feedstock material when the scrap chopper is in a closed position. A web jam detection circuit is electrically connected to the web detection bar. In operation, the web jam detection circuit supplies direct current electricity to the web detection bar and generates feedback signals based on a voltage of the web detection bar. The feedback signals are indicative of the presence or absence of the feedstock material at the plurality of web detection fingers.
